With six operating terminals, JFK Airport can be overwhelming, especially for first-time travelers. Each terminal has its own unique character, with different airlines, restaurants, and amenities. Terminal 1, for example, is home to airlines like Air France and Japan Airlines, while Terminal 4 is a major hub for Delta Air Lines. Understanding the layout of each terminal and the services they offer can help you plan your trip more efficiently. Additionally, knowing the various transportation options available, such as the AirTrain, taxis, and ride-hailing services, can make getting to and from the airport a breeze.
